Sheridan’s
There are times when you aren’t looking for a full meal, but a dessert place where you’re pet is welcome. Located on Grand Boulevard in Kansas City, Sheridan’s is the perfect place to bring your pooch. Go ahead and satisfy your sweet tooth with the delicious offerings here. If your pet has a sweet tooth as well, they even offer vanilla puppy cones just the right size for your dog.
Aixois
Aixois is a family owned bistro and coffee bar located in the heart of Kansas City on East 55th Street. You will enjoy the casual and relaxed atmosphere at this quaint French restaurant that welcomes your and the whole family, including Fido. According to petfriendlyrestaurants.com, this place is both kid and pet friendly and encourages the whole family to enjoy the French cuisine here. Blue Bird Bistro
If dining outdoors is what you like, then the patio at Blue Bird Bistro is just the place to stop when you’re traveling with pets in the Kansas City area. The patio is open all summer long and they welcome you and your pet.
Some restaurants reserve their outdoor seating for special parties and celebrations. It’s a good idea to check in advance that there is adequate space on the patio for you and your pet before you head out to one of these fine establishments.
